A Consumer Financial Protection Bureau rule targeting digital payment platforms run by Apple Inc., Alphabet Inc.'s Google, and Meta Platforms Inc.'s Facebook is one step closer to repeal after the Senate voted to eliminate it.
The Senate has voted to overturn key regulations that granted the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au supervision over payment services operated by platforms such as PayPal, Google, and Apple.
